Sassho, I like the Pixon12, too. Itīs optics are truly sharp, its dynamic range @ base ISO sensitivities is amazing, and I agree with you on that. It also has manual selectable ISO settings, and, with ISO-50, one can take really amazing shots with it during the day.

The thing is that itīs only worth it if you use it @ the base ISO settings.

Using anything above ISO-200 is waste of time. It simply kills all the noise, and so the detail vanishes completely. Fitting ISO 400+ on that phone was pure gimmickry. The Satio absolutely smashes it down when it comes to low light photography, and so does the N8.

Besides that, itīs well known that the Pixon12īs lens has a pronnounced barrel distortion, and, under warm light, like @ the sunset or @ dawn, sometimes the colour channels could get completely messed up, no matter which setting I used.

On 2010-10-19 14:17:46, zide wrote:
Just got my new (used) silver satio! Iayks!

Have you hacked your Satio? The only app that I'm going to install is the SPB Shell 3.5. Do I need to hack it in order to install that?



If youīre trying to install an unsigned app, then you have either to sign it or to have your phone hacked.

If youīre trying to install a paid app, then you donīt have to do neither of these.
